MINE SHILDREN.

Oh, dhose shildren, dhose shildren, dhey boddher mine life!
Vhy don'd dhey keep qviet, like Katrine, mine vife?
Vot makes dhem so shock fool off mischief, I vunder,
A-shumping der room roundt mit noises like dunderf
Hear dot! Vas dhere anyding make sooch a noise
As Yawcob und Otto, mine two leedle poys?
Ven I dake oup mine pipe for a goot qviet shmoke
Dhey crawl me all ofer, und dink id a shoke
To go droo mine bockets to see vot dhey find,
Und if mit der latch-key mine vatch dhey can vind.
Id dakes someding more as dheir fader und moder
To qviet dot Otto und his leedle broder.
Dhey shtub oudt dheir boots, und vear holes in der knees
Off dheir drousers und shtockings, und sooch dings as dhese.
I dink if dot Crœsus vas lifing to-day,:
Dhose poys make more bills as dot Kaiser could pay;
I find me qvick oudt dot some riches dake vings,
Ven each gouple a tays I must buy dhem new dings.
I pring dhose two shafers some toys efry tay.
Pecause "Shonny Schwartz has sooch nice dings," dhey say,
"Und Shonny Schwartz' barents vas poorer as ve"-
Dot's vot der young rashkells vas saying to me.
Dot oldt Santa Klaus, mit a shleigh fool off toys,
Don'd gif sadisfactious to dhose greedy poys.
Dhey kick der clothes off vhen ashleep in dheir ped,
Und get so mooch croup dot dhey almosdt vas dead;
Budt id don'd made no tifferent: before id vas light
Dhey vas onp in der morning mit pillows to fight;
I dink id was beddher you don'd got some ears
Vhen dhey blay " Holdt der Fort," und dhen gif dree cheers.
Oh, dhose shildren, dhose shildren, dhey boddher mine life!—
But shtop shust a leedle. If Katrine, mine vife,
Und dhose leedle shildren, dhey don'd been around,
Und all droo der house dhere vas neffer a sound—
Vell, poys, vhy you look oup dot vay mit surbrise?
I guess dhey see tears in dheir old fader's eyes.
